The Eragon Video Game is being produced by Vivendi Universal Games, a group off of Stormfront Studios. The game will be playable on the following consoles: PC, Xbox/360, PS2/PSP, Gamecube, Game Boy Advance (GBA), and Nintendo DS. The game was released in stores on November 14th, 2006.

Summary of the Handheld Games

The PSP, GBA, and Nintendo DS are the handheld consoles that will have the Eragon game available for playing.

PSP - Dragon Fight and Arena Combat

  • Four person multiplayer in seven different arenas with twelve unlockable arena game types.
  • Unlockable and customizable dragon armor.
  • Extensive single player story mode – experience the Eragon story from Saphira the dragon’s point of view.

GBA - Story Driven, Turn Based RPG

  • Nine playable characters.
  • True RPG leveling system with fully customizable focus skills.
  • Upgradeable weapon forging and potion crafting.
  • Deep story fully explores the Eragon universe.

Nintendo DS - Action/Combat RPG

  • Touch screen spell casting and unique dual screen attack mode.
  • Extensive weapon, spell and combo attack upgrade system.
  • Sharpen your magic and dragon riding skills in two unlockable mini-games.

Strategy Guide

The official Eragon Game Strategy Guide will be published by Primagames and authored by Dan Birlew.
